
Tinubu welcomes Nigeria into World Energy Council
President Tinubu congratulated the inaugural leadership of WEC Nigeria – Mr Abdulrazaq Isa, OFR, as Chairman and Mr Bala Wunti as Chief Executive Officer – alongside other distinguished Nigerians drawn from across the energy value chain, regulatory institutions, industry associations, finance, academia and the Future Energy Leaders community, who will serve as inaugural Board members.
By Johnbosco Agbakwuru, Abuja President Bola Tinubu, has welcomed the formal admission of Nigeria as the newest National Member Committee of the World Energy Council (WEC), describing it as a proud moment for the nation and a strong vote of confidence in Nigeria’s energy reforms and leadership role in Africa.
The President described Mr Wunti as one of Nigeria’s finest energy strategists and reform champions whose over three decades of exemplary service, defined by integrity and strategic vision, have been marked by landmark reforms that significantly enhanced national revenues and restored investor confidence in Nigeria’s energy sector.
